The duration of slides (still images) can be controlled in three ways...

 

1) Setting the default duration under the Tools/Options/Media window before adding any clips to VP

2) Going into Storyboard mode and changing the duration shown for that slide under the thumbnail

3) Grabbing the leading or trailing edge of the image clip on the timeline and dragging it right or left.

 

- and normally you should have no problem in changing the value to something larger than the current value, so I don't know why it should be fixed at 3.97. If you haven't already, try the last two options and see what happens
